There is a several versions of Netsurf for a 68k Amiga.

Official is here https://ci.netsurf-browser.org/builds/amigaos3/

It is badly broken, bitmap fonts code is broken, menus has a problems, etc. it has also lost it's speed after 2017 https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=ZueeEUIazNM

Use this version, SSL actually works on it: https://www.cy2.uk/netsurf.lha https://aminet.net/package/comm/www/netsurf_os3

Whether it works reliably is another matter. It's pretty stable on my MiSTer, provided the latest AmiSSL is installed. Others have reported problems.

Unfortunately this version is broken on AOS3 the picture/background rendering is completely broken.
Pity as its the first netsurf for AOS3 that has a proper menu with Preferences etc..
The only versions that are *almost* working onn AOS are 3.10 that is very slow and 3.9. both are crashing demons thought. It is very difficult to browse more than 3-4 pages without stop responding with my PiStorm32 with Pi3A+
From the other hand its the only browser on AOS3 that support CSS, ibrowse 3 is a polished amiga browser but lucking CSS makes the price for me not worthy. otherwise I would bought it in a heartbeat.

I know it's unhelpful but it "works here". Images are generally broken on 8-bit screen modes, but still useable.

It's still labelled as a beta for a reason!

If you can track down the problems you are having then patches will be welcome. However I'm not seeing most of the issues here that others are - which makes it difficult to debug.

It’s like CoffinOS found on the Vampire Cards but it’s for the PiStorm. It will be a bespoke build of Amiga OS 3.9. With a load of extras. So nothing vanilla about it.

Ah, in that case I can say "not supported", you're on your own.

AmigaOS 3.9 should work.  AmigaOS 3.2.2.1 should work.  But either of those with a ton of extra patches and hacks I wouldn't expect to work correctly.  Even the plain versions of 3.9 and 3.2 are temperamental.  I want to rebuild it with the 3.2 NDK and (if necessary) ditch 3.9, to see if that makes it more stable - the classes can then work more or less exactly as they do in OS4 so it should help.  But the NDK won't work properly in my build environment currently.
